Transaction 5884fd7b5753cf890e1ffb1520a789174ba7211fa093d236943b8a53a317a210

1 Input
2 Outputs
  • 5884fd7b5753cf890e1ffb1520a789174ba7211fa093d236943b8a53a317a210:0
  • value  3152506
    address  1KAh43tTBxJPfW4nPSczSc143bchMP9Nkf
  • 5884fd7b5753cf890e1ffb1520a789174ba7211fa093d236943b8a53a317a210:1
  • value  278052814
    address  15aKPg8Pkx1iE73XDCi1X5swd8MjbAasBM